Python is one of the most versatile and in-demand programming languages today. Known for its simplicity, readability, and power, Python is used in a wide range of fields, from web development to artificial intelligence, data analysis, and automation. If you want to future-proof your career in technology, mastering Python is the way to go. Our Python language course is designed to cater to everyone, whether you’re a complete beginner or an experienced programmer looking to enhance your skill set. With hands-on projects, expert guidance, and flexible learning modules, this course will transform you into a proficient Python developer.
Why Learn Python?
Python’s versatility and ease of use make it the go-to programming language for developers worldwide. Here are some reasons to invest in learning Python:
- Beginner-Friendly: Python’s clean and simple syntax allows you to focus on problem-solving rather than syntax errors.
- Widely Used: Python is employed in various domains, including web development, data science, AI, machine learning, game development, and automation.
- High Demand: Python developers are highly sought after in the tech industry, with competitive salaries and growth opportunities.
- Extensive Libraries: Python boasts an extensive ecosystem of libraries and frameworks like Django, Flask, NumPy, Pandas, and TensorFlow, making development faster and easier.
- Community Support: Python has a large, active community that offers a wealth of resources and support for learners.
What You’ll Learn?
Our Python course is carefully structured to guide you through the fundamentals and advanced concepts, ensuring a deep understanding of the language and its applications.
1. Introduction to Python
- Understanding Python’s significance and use cases.
- Installing and setting up Python on your system.
- Writing your first Python program.
2. Core Python Concepts
- Data types, variables, and operators.
- Control structures: if-else, loops, and more.
- Functions, modules, and packages.
3. Object-Oriented Programming (OOP)
- Classes, objects, and inheritance.
- Encapsulation and polymorphism.
4. File Handling and Exception Handling
- Reading, writing, and manipulating files.
- Handling errors gracefully with exceptions.
5. Data Science with Python
- Using libraries like NumPy and Pandas for data manipulation.
- Visualizing data with Matplotlib and Seaborn.
6. Web Development with Python
- Building dynamic websites using Django and Flask.
- Working with APIs and integrating third-party services.
7. Automation and Scripting
- Automating repetitive tasks using Python.
- Writing scripts for web scraping and data extraction.
8. Advanced Topics
- Introduction to machine learning with Python.
- Exploring AI, neural networks, and TensorFlow.